Trump Condemns Attack
- On December 13, 2025, an ambush in Palmyra, Syria killed two U.S. soldiers and a civilian interpreter.
- The attack is attributed to a suspected Islamic State (IS) member.
- Initial assessments indicate the attacker was affiliated with the Syrian security forces and had extremist views.
- U.S. President Donald Trump condemned the attack and pledged "very serious retaliation."
- The United States maintains roughly 900 troops in Syria.
